This Tuesday a Airbus A321-200 plane of the Air Busan airline, destined to Hong Konghe caught fire before taking off from Gimhae International Airport, In the city of Busanin southeast South Korea.

The incident occurred at 22:26 (local time) and The flames originated in the tail From the plane, firefighters reported. The 169 passengers and seven crew members were evacuated Through a slide, Yonhap agency reported.

It was also reported that three people were slightly injured during an evacuation. The fire was completely extinguished at 23:31 (Argentine time), approximately one hour after firefighters arrived at the scene.

The authorities indicated that four people suffered wounds During the evacuation, two of which were treated in a nearby hospital.

It took about an hour to turn off the flames, which extended throughout the vehicle’s fuselage.

On December 29, a Boeing 737-800 of the airline Jeju Air crashed into a wall and exploded when landing at Muan airport, in the southwest of South Koreawhere 179 of the 181 people who were traveling on board died.

The flight was returning from Bangkok And the victims were mainly South Korean, except two Thai citizens. An initial report revealed that traces of bird impacts were found on the plane’s engines, but the exact cause of the accident has not yet been determined.
